  2. Hello, I've just started to build my helicopter cockpit. I use the simkits multi controller board for my switches. This board has a total of 3X 25 lines, so 1 line input, output or servo. So i can install a total of 25 inputs, outputs or servo's to it, if i have one input on line one, there cant be anything else on the output or servo of line 1. Now my question is: I have installed a switch for my fuel pump eng.1 on line 1 and a led on line 2. The switch sends his command via fsuipc. Is it possible to link it with the led also driven by fsuipc? So when my fuel pump or avionic etc is in its off position, i see the appropriate warning led, and when the switch is turned on, the led goes off? Sorry for my bad english!
